HC Deb 15 April 1964 vol 693 cc74-5W
Sir B. Janner

asked the Minister of Transport whether he will consider the desirability of introducing into Great Britain the use of temporary portable steel highways which can be assembled in a few hours to enable traffic to flow unimpeded when part of a motorway has to be closed for repairs, such as have recently been introduced in West Germany.

Mr. Marples

Such repairs as have been necessary up to now have not caused congestion. But I will consider the use of temporary structures in the future if undue congestion seems likely.
